B000mra4wk01_aa240_sclzzzzzzz_v45_2 The new Modest Mouse is out and it's number one on iTunes and number twelve on Amazon. Not bad for an indie rock band.

I've had the pleasure of listening to this record for the past six weeks and I love it. Issac Brock speaks to me.  He isn't the greatest singer. He isn't the greatest songwriter. But ever since the Gotham Gal and I went to see Modest Mouse play at Hammerstein several years ago, I have had this thing for Modest Mouse's music. I love the way Isaac spits out the vocals like a machine gun.

The early reviews say there isn't a single like Float On on this record. Surely Dashboard isn't in that category, but Missed The Boat and People As Places sure are.
